Choosing the Right Fabric for Durability and Weather Resistance

One of the first aspects to examine when evaluating a rooftop tent is the quality of its fabric, as this determines its longevity and performance in diverse outdoor conditions. High-quality waterproof roof tents utilize fabrics with superior water repellency and resistance to UV degradation, ensuring that the tent maintains its structural integrity and protective functions even under prolonged sun exposure or heavy rainfall. Distributors should focus on materials such as high-denier polyester or ripstop nylon, which are not only lightweight but also highly resistant to tearing and abrasion, providing long-term durability for overlanders and camping enthusiasts alike. Moreover, tents that integrate breathable layers enhance comfort by minimizing condensation buildup inside the tent, which is a frequent concern for end users.


Frame and Base Materials: Aluminum vs Steel vs Composite

The structural framework of a rooftop tent plays a decisive role in its stability and lifespan. Aluminum rooftop tent frames are particularly valued for their combination of lightweight construction and high strength, allowing for easier handling and transport without compromising durability, while steel frames offer superior strength but may add considerable weight, which can affect fuel efficiency and vehicle balance. Composite materials, often reinforced with fiberglass or carbon fiber, offer innovative solutions that balance weight and robustness, appealing to distributors seeking advanced products that differentiate their portfolio. Assessing the frame’s welds, joints, and load-bearing capacity is essential, as it impacts the tent’s ability to withstand high winds, uneven terrain, and repeated deployments.


Zipper, Stitching, and Reinforcement Inspection

Attention to detail in construction is a hallmark of premium rooftop tents. Strong, corrosion-resistant zippers, reinforced stitching, and double-stitched seams are indicators of high-quality products capable of enduring frequent use. Distributors should verify these elements through sample inspection, ensuring that all closures function smoothly and that reinforcement in stress-prone areas such as corners and entry points enhances longevity. Investing in tents with these robust components reduces the likelihood of post-sale complaints and demonstrates commitment to supplying durable overlanding tents that meet professional standards.


Waterproofing and Weatherproof Features

Evaluating the water and weather resistance of a rooftop tent is critical, particularly for buyers serving markets with variable climates. All-weather rooftop tents must combine high-quality fabrics with sealed seams, waterproof coatings, and a sturdy rainfly to prevent leaks and withstand heavy precipitation. Additionally, tents with proper ventilation systems allow moisture to escape, reducing the risk of mold and maintaining a dry interior, which directly impacts user satisfaction. For distributors, emphasizing waterproofing and structural reliability helps build trust with retailers and end customers, reinforcing the reputation for sourcing durable outdoor gear.


Fire Retardant and Safety Standards Compliance

Safety compliance is increasingly important, and distributors must ensure that rooftop tents meet recognized fire resistant rooftop tents standards and certifications. This includes flammability tests, adherence to local regulatory requirements, and verification of any safety labels provided by manufacturers. Choosing suppliers who prioritize safety demonstrates professionalism and positions distributors as reliable partners in the outdoor equipment market, particularly when supplying high-value bulk orders.


Ease of Setup and Fold Mechanisms

Ease of use is a primary concern for both casual campers and professional overlanders. Quick deploy rooftop tents provide a significant advantage by enabling users to set up shelter rapidly without extensive tools, while foldable traditional designs offer compact storage and convenient transport for frequent travelers. Distributors should evaluate the mechanical efficiency of fold mechanisms, hinge durability, and overall setup ergonomics to ensure that purchased products align with real-world user needs, reducing barriers to adoption and enhancing customer satisfaction.


Integrated Mattress and Comfort Features

Consumer expectations for comfort have risen alongside advancements in tent design. Rooftop tents featuring built-in mattresses and interior padding improve the sleeping experience, particularly for long-term or repeated use. Distributors evaluating bulk orders must assess the quality, thickness, and durability of these materials to guarantee comfort for end users and to justify premium pricing. Comfortable, well-designed tents also contribute to higher repeat purchases and positive feedback from retailers and consumers.


Ventilation and Temperature Control Options

Proper airflow and ventilation are essential for maintaining a comfortable environment inside the tent. Ventilated rooftop tents equipped with multiple mesh panels, adjustable windows, and breathable fabrics help regulate interior temperature while minimizing condensation. Distributors should consider these features when assessing product suitability for various climates, ensuring that tents provide consistent comfort in both hot summer conditions and cooler, rainy environments.


Accessibility and Ladder Stability

Secure and stable access is critical, particularly for elevated rooftop tents. Evaluating roof tent ladder safety, including anti-slip feet, adjustable height, and structural strength, ensures that users can enter and exit the tent safely under all conditions. Distributors must verify ladder designs, load ratings, and ease of attachment during sample inspection to guarantee that products meet professional safety expectations.


Storage and Modular Accessories Compatibility

Modern rooftop tents often include modular accessory options such as awnings, annexes, and storage solutions. Roof tent storage options and modular rooftop tent accessories compatibility expand the functional utility of the tent, allowing distributors to appeal to overlanders seeking integrated camping setups. Assessing these features prior to bulk procurement ensures that purchased products offer versatility and meet evolving consumer expectations.


Supplier Certification and Manufacturing Standards

Choosing the right supplier is as important as evaluating the tent itself. Verified ISO certified rooftop tent manufacturers and OEM suppliers provide confidence in consistent production quality, adherence to specifications, and reliable after-sales support. For distributors, sourcing from reputable factories reduces risk, ensures compliance with international standards, and strengthens relationships with retail partners.


Bulk Order Sample Testing Before Purchase

Before placing large orders, distributors should conduct sample testing to verify performance under real-world conditions. Evaluating durability, setup efficiency, waterproofing, and user comfort allows distributors to make informed decisions and prevent potential post-sale issues. Sample quality check rooftop tent processes are critical to ensuring that the bulk order meets both technical and customer satisfaction standards.


Warranty, Return Policy, and After-Sales Support

Distributors must assess supplier warranties, return policies, and after-sales support, as these factors affect long-term relationships with retailers and customers. Reliable coverage and clear support procedures reassure buyers that issues such as defects or manufacturing inconsistencies can be resolved efficiently, making bulk procurement less risky and fostering long-term trust.


Reputation and Customer Reviews Analysis

Analyzing reviews and industry reputation is a practical way to validate quality. Verified customer feedback tents and references from other distributors provide insights into reliability, durability, and overall satisfaction, helping buyers avoid suppliers with inconsistent quality records.


Production Capacity and Lead Time Considerations

Bulk orders require suppliers with sufficient production capacity and realistic lead times. Evaluating high-volume rooftop tent supply ensures that distributors can meet market demand without delays, avoiding stockouts or delivery issues that could affect retail partnerships and revenue streams.


Wind Resistance and Structural Integrity

Outdoor environments subject rooftop tents to strong winds and uneven terrain. Assessing windproof rooftop tents for frame rigidity, anchor points, and load-bearing capacity ensures that the tent can withstand adverse conditions, maintaining safety and reliability during frequent use.


Waterproof Testing Under Extreme Conditions

Testing tents under simulated or real heavy rain conditions is essential. Leakproof tent testing verifies that fabrics, seams, and rainflies function correctly, preventing water ingress and ensuring customer satisfaction, particularly in regions with high rainfall.
